ऋग्वेद ३.२०.१

Ṛgveda 3.20.1

ṛṣi
गाथी कौशिकः
devatā
अग्निः, १, ५ विश्वे देवाः
chandas
त्रिष्टुप्

a̱gnimu̱ṣasa̍ma̱śvinā̍ dadhi̱krāṃ vyu̍ṣṭiṣu havate̱ vahni̍ru̱kthaiḥ |su̱jyoti̍ṣo naḥ śṛṇvantu de̱vāḥ sa̱joṣa̍so adhva̱raṃ vā̍vaśā̱nāḥ ||

Transliteration IAST

a̱gnimu̱ṣasa̍ma̱śvinā̍ dadhi̱krāṃ vyu̍ṣṭiṣu havate̱ vahni̍ru̱kthaiḥ | su̱jyoti̍ṣo naḥ śṛṇvantu de̱vāḥ sa̱joṣa̍so adhva̱raṃ vā̍vaśā̱nāḥ ||

Padapāṭha word by word, as recited

अग्निम् | उषसम् | अश्विना | दधि-क्राम् | वि-उष्टिषु | हवते | वह्निः | उक्थैः | सु-ज्योतिषः | नः | शृण्वन्तु | देवाः | स-जोषसः | अध्वरम् | वावशानाः

agnim | uṣasam | aśvinā | dadhi-krām | vi-uṣṭiṣu | havate | vahniḥ | ukthaiḥ | su-jyotiṣaḥ | naḥ | śṛṇvantu | devāḥ | sa-joṣasaḥ | adhvaram | vāvaśānāḥ

Translations signed

WITH lauds at break of morn the priest invoketh Agni, Dawn, Dadhikras, and both the Asvins. With one consent the Gods whose light is splendid, longing to taste our sacrifice, shall hear us.

Ralph T.H. GriffithThe Hymns of the Rigveda, translated with a popular commentary, 1896 · public domain
